A Canadian man has been charged with dangerous driving causing death after he allegedly drove into pedestrians chosen at random, including children, in the Quebec province town of Amqui, killing two men and injuring nine people. Authorities believe the incident was a deliberate attack, but have not commented on a possible motive. The accused, Steeve Gagnon, will remain detained until April 5, and more charges are expected to follow. The incident is not believed to be related to terrorism or national security.
